Types of CCTV Cameras Commonly Used in Dubai
When choosing the best CCTV installation service in Dubai, you must understand the types of cameras available:
-
Dome Cameras – Ideal for shops and offices; discreet and provide 360-degree coverage.
-
Bullet Cameras – Perfect for outdoor surveillance; long range and weatherproof.
-
PTZ Cameras (Pan-Tilt-Zoom) – Remote-controlled for flexible movement and zooming.
-
IP Cameras – Internet-enabled cameras with high-definition video and remote access.
-
Wireless Cameras – Easy installation, no heavy cabling required.
-
Night Vision Cameras – Equipped with infrared for clear footage in darkness.
-
Thermal Cameras – Detect heat signatures, used in sensitive industrial areas.
-
Hidden Cameras – Covert surveillance for discreet monitoring.

Dubai Laws and Regulations for CCTV Installation
If you’re planning to install CCTV in Dubai, it’s important to know the legal requirements:
-
Business Compliance – Hotels, financial institutions, retail outlets, schools, warehouses, and residential buildings must have CCTV cameras as per SIRA.
-
Privacy Rules – Cameras should not invade personal privacy (e.g., neighbors’ houses, private property).
-
Storage Requirements – Businesses must store CCTV footage for at least 30 to 90 days, depending on regulations.
-
Approved Installers Only – Only SIRA-approved companies can install CCTV for commercial purposes.
Failure to comply can result in heavy fines or business license issues.

Cost of CCTV Installation in Dubai
Pricing depends on property size, number of cameras, and features. Here’s a general breakdown:
-
Home Packages – AED 999 to AED 5,000 (4–8 cameras).
-
Office Packages – AED 3,000 to AED 15,000.
-
Retail & Commercial – AED 5,000 to AED 50,000 depending on scale.
-
High-Security Solutions (AI & 4K) – AED 20,000 to AED 100,000+.

FAQs – Best CCTV Installation Service in Dubai
1. Is CCTV mandatory in Dubai?
Yes, many businesses must comply with Dubai Police and SIRA regulations.
2. How many cameras do I need for my villa in Dubai?
Most villas require 4–8 cameras for full coverage.
3. Can I monitor my CCTV cameras remotely?
Yes, via mobile apps and computer software.
4. How long is CCTV footage stored in Dubai?
Between 30 and 90 days, depending on property type.
5. Which is better—wired or wireless CCTV cameras?
Wired cameras are more stable; wireless ones are easier to install.
6. Are CCTV cameras weatherproof for Dubai heat?
Yes, outdoor cameras are built for high-temperature resistance.
7. How much does commercial CCTV installation cost?
Anywhere between AED 5,000–50,000 depending on scale.
8. Do I need special permission to install CCTV at home?
Not usually, unless cameras point towards public or private property of others.
9. What features should I look for in a CCTV camera?
HD video, night vision, motion detection, remote access, and warranty.
10. Can CCTV cameras reduce my insurance cost in Dubai?
Yes, some insurers provide discounts for secured properties.
11. How often should I maintain my CCTV system?
At least every 6–12 months.
12. Which brand of CCTV is best in Dubai?
Popular brands include Hikvision, Dahua, Axis, and Bosch.
13. Can CCTV cameras record sound?
Some models do, but privacy laws may restrict audio recording in certain areas.
14. Can I integrate CCTV with other smart systems?
Yes, modern CCTV systems can be linked with alarms and smart locks.
15. Who regulates CCTV installation in Dubai?
SIRA (Security Industry Regulatory Agency).
